High speed, high accuracy RF power measurements up to an unrivalled 67 GHz with the R&S NRP67S/SN power sensorsRohde & Schwarz has increased the maximum measurable frequency of its three-path diode power sensors to an unrivalled 67 GHz. The three-path technology enables extremely fast and accurate power measurements with a high-sensitivity, portable instrument of minimum size and weight. This frequency extension makes high speed power measurements possible for additional applications such as IEEE 802.11ay and 802.11ad WiGig Wireless LAN, millimeter-wave terrestrial short distance communication links, and satellite-satellite links operating at 60 GHz.

Rohde & Schwarz validates first 5G RRM FR2 conformance tests with the R&S TS-RRM-NR test systemThe Global Certification Forum (GCF) has approved the first two radio ressource management (RRM) conformance test cases for 5G FR2 frequencies, implemented on the R&S TS-RRM-NR 5G RRM conformance test system from Rohde & Schwarz. The test cases have been validated in seven FR2 and LTE band combinations. With this success, Rohde & Schwarz is leading the way in validated test cases for the technically challenging FR2 mmWave frequency bands.
